Pakistan LNG skips Trafigura, Gunvor deliveries

Pakistan LNG decided against awarding a tender for three LNG cargo deliveries in December and January to two Swiss-based trading houses.

Pakistan LNG decided against awarding slots for three LNG cargo deliveries in December and January to two Swiss-based trading houses.

Trafigura has been selected as a supplier under a tender seeking four shipments for December, Reuters reports, citing trade sources.

Trafigura has reportedly submitted the lowest bid for the December 1-2 window while Gunvor and B.B. Energy placed bids to deliver the remaining three cargoes for the month.

Under a tender seeking January shipments, Gunvor placed the lowest bids for two delivery slots, namely the January 16-17 and 21-22, however, neither will be awarded.

Sources were reported as saying the company did not favour the prices.

The cargoes sought in the tender are to be delivered to BW Group’s FSRU BW Integrity that will serve as Pakistan’s second LNG terminal at Port Qasim. The vessel is employed by PGP consortium, a subsidiary of Pakistan GasPort consortium.

However, the LNG terminal project has been delayed for months as the connecting pipeline has still not been completed.
